I have a similar situation on a 99 neon. I have visible oil on the spark plug wire in the plug cavity, as well as on the plugs themselves, the only one that appears to have oil in the cylinder is #1 plug. Is this a known problem for the neons, and is it easily fixable? If so, how so? Also, the #1 plug is very dirty as though it is not firing correctly, I replaced all 4 plug yesterday (10-12-09). I checked to see that the coil is working, and got good spark, so I am guessing that I have an possible oil leak fouling out that plug. Could this be the reason for the over all chugging and hesitation of the engine. The code scanner simply gives a generic misfire code for cylinder 1. I appreciate any constructive help. Thank you |
